Description
Discontinued as of Summer Semester 2025.
Students acquire personal care and assistance skills within the parameters of the health care assistant role. Students develop the caregiver skills necessary to maintain and promote the comfort, safety, and independence of individuals in community and facility contexts. Students are required to integrate theory from other courses as they complete the class and supervised laboratory experiences.
Registration in this course is restricted to students admitted to the Certificate in Health Care Assistant.
Corequisites: HCAS 1100, 1101, 1110, 1120, 1130, and 1220.
